Output e99a3baa1f1067b5a7899c1b74cade25c26e752a29948c7fa64eb33c9b757509:0

value
8010486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 270bbd6890fec35ce9984ba1880221a341bcad6a OP_EQUAL
address
MBTcecUkheRMBWE8nkLPfS38br1DhYFECz
transaction
e99a3baa1f1067b5a7899c1b74cade25c26e752a29948c7fa64eb33c9b757509
spent
true